Join the IIRER for our one-day Symposium on Mental Health and Work: Innovative Clinical Applications in Private and Forensic Sectors.
The IIRER Symposium on Mental Health and Work will provide a unique opportunity for professionals in Illinois and surrounding areas to enhance knowledge and skills in serving clients with mental health and other health conditions. There will be an emphasis on both the challenges and the innovative clinical applications that have influenced our practices and education in the fields of mental health and vocational rehabilitation, particularly in private and forensic sectors. This symposium will provide sessions on the application of Illinois Work and Well-Being Model, post-pandemic mental health issues and practices, intake challenges, addictions, and emerging ethics issues in private practices. Overall, the symposium aims to bring together mental health and vocational rehabilitation professionals across the state and provide enriching discussions to improve clinical practices.
